When selecting a weighing scale pallet truck, understanding the various types available is crucial. There are three main categories: digital, mechanical, and hybrid models. Digital models are favored for their precision. They provide accurate weight readings, often within 0.1% tolerance. A report by the International Society of Weighing Technology stated that digital scales enhance efficiency by up to 25% in warehouse operations.
Mechanical models are simpler. They do not require batteries or electrical connections, making them a reliable choice in environments where power supply is an issue. However, their accuracy can be limited, typically around 0.5% tolerance. Hybrid models combine features of both. They offer both mechanical reliability and digital accuracy. Users should assess their operational needs carefully; less emphasis on precision might suit some environments better.
Consider the capacity and platform size as well. Standard capacities range from 1,000 to 5,000 kg. A mismatch might lead to inaccuracies or equipment failure. Additionally, the platform dimensions should fit typical loads for optimal efficiency. Organizations must also weigh the importance of features like portability and ease of storage. Each type has strengths and weaknesses, so thoughtful evaluation is essential.
When selecting a weighing scale pallet truck, measurement accuracy and weight capacity are essential factors. A reliable scale should accurately reflect the weight of your loads. This can prevent discrepancies and potential financial losses. An inaccurate scale may lead to overloading or underutilization of resources.
Understanding weight capacity is crucial as well. Each scale has a maximum load limit, which varies across models. Exceeding this limit can damage the truck and compromise safety. Regularly check the specifications enlisted by the manufacturer. If possible, test the scale with known weights to ensure its accuracy.
Tips: Always calibrate your pallet truck regularly. This ensures that readings remain precise. If unsure, consult with experts to better understand measurement standards. Keep your truck clean; dirt may affect the scale's performance. Assess your loading practices. Improper weight distribution can lead to inaccuracies too. Strive for a balanced load to enhance measurement reliability.
| Feature | Description | Importance |
|---|---|---|
| Weight Capacity | The maximum weight the pallet truck can handle, usually ranging from 1500 kg to 3000 kg. | Critical for ensuring the safe and effective transportation of heavy materials. |
| Measurement Accuracy | The precision of the weight display, typically within ±1% of the actual weight. | Essential for accurate inventory management and auditing. |
| Platform Size | Dimensions of the platform to accommodate different pallet sizes, often 1200mm x 800mm. | Important for compatibility with various pallets. |
| Battery Life | Duration the battery lasts on a full charge, usually 6 to 12 hours. | Crucial for operations requiring extended usage without recharging. |
| Durability | Quality of materials used, affecting resistance to wear and tear. | Important for long-term reliability and performance under heavy use. |
